-->

Website Hosting on Google | Virtual Private Cloud (VPC) | Google Cloud

Website Hosting on Google Cloud Virtual Private Server.

Google Cloud Platform has flexible and reliable technology that can be used to run websites. This infrastructure provides the same level of security as Google websites, including Google. com, Gmail, and Youtube.

Google Cloud Platform has different options, including cloud storage, virtual machines, and containers. If you are starting on a platform, you may need to use Google's virtual machine. 

Google's virtual machine use paradigm is similar to the virtual private server services provided by other cloud hosting providers. In this guide, we will explain how to host your website on Google Cloud.



Website Hosting on Google Cloud Virtual Private Server

How to host on a Google Cloud virtual private server? 

Here are 5 ways to host your website on Google Cloud:


1. To purchase a domain name

You must register it with your favorite registrar. You can also use Google Domains to put your hosting solution in one place. The price of the domain name depends on the web host you specify. All registrars provide custom domain name server (DNS) records.


2. Host your website on Google

You can use Google Cloud storage to host static websites. However, your website will be in read-only mode, and your visitors will not be able to interact with you, such as being unable to comment or register on your website.

If you want to run dynamic websites, Google provides virtual machines for Windows and Linux operating systems. If the website load of advanced users is large and needs to be distributed in a hosting cluster, you can use containers.

Virtual machines work well for most users because they can run all types of websites, including WordPress..


3. Set up Google Compute Engine

VMs on the Google Compute machine infrastructure are called instances. You can customize your instance by selecting your preferred operating system, physical storage, CPU, and RAM. It will depend on your budget.

Google has a price estimator that allows you to roughly determine the monthly cost of your instance, which can serve as a good guide.

You can also use Google Cloud Launcher to implement a complete website service stack and install many of the software applications used on the website, including; WordPress, Joomla, Django, etc.

If you want to fully customize the virtual machine, you will need to install an operating system that supports Web development. Although Windows is a good choice for those who run. With Clean technology and ASP, most of the developers choose to host their websites on Linux.


4. Prepare the LAMP stack

An open-source operating system like Linux is can run on desktops as well as servers. To use Linux to host your website, you need to implement a LAMP stack. These include; all Linux distributions (such as Ubuntu, CentOs, Arch Linux, Debian, Fedora, etc.), Apache, MySQL, and PHP

You can start with Ubuntu as it is the most popular and there are many tutorials online. At the time of writing this guide, the most stable version is Ubuntu 18.04.

After selecting the operating system, you will need to install a web server, such as Apache or NGNIX. In addition, most websites provide dynamic content, thus requiring a database. You can choose MySQL or MariaDB. Both are open-source relational database management software, and they work well.


5. Link your domain to your host

You now have a domain name and a hosting solution provided by Google. You need to link the two for your website to work properly. In most cases, you will have to change the A record to point to your server's public IP address. You can also use Google's cloud DNS service to manage your domain name servers. Finally, test your website by visiting your domain name in a browser.


Conclusion

Hosting your website on Google is a great move. This means that your website will run on the strong and fast network that Google has built over the years. You'll use Google's distributed website services and unmatched security features.


Protected by Copyscape

Related Posts